Song Meaning
The narrator is caught in a loop, repeatedly asking someone to join them in a "dejavu." This isn't just a fleeting sense of familiarity; it's presented as a destination, a place or state they want to share. The insistent repetition of the question creates a feeling of desperation, as if the invitation is crucial for escaping this cycle or perhaps for understanding it.
The core tension lies in the unanswered plea. The repeated question, "Why won't you come with me?" highlights a disconnect or refusal from the other person. This suggests a longing for shared experience, a desire to pull someone else into this recurring phenomenon, but facing an obstacle that prevents it. The phrase "my dejavu" implies a personal, perhaps overwhelming, experience that the narrator feels compelled to share.
The primary craft element is the relentless repetition of the central question and the term "dejavu." This structure mirrors the very concept it describes, trapping the listener in the same sonic and thematic loop as the narrator. The simplicity of the language, focusing on a single plea, amplifies the emotional weight of the unanswered question and the implied isolation of the narrator's experience.
